Ordinals
beta
Sat 788025999124055
decimal
157605.999124055
degree
0°157605′357″999124055‴
percentile
37.52504761861352%
name
igpofdaohzm
cycle
0
epoch
0
period
78
block
157605
offset
999124055
timestamp
2011-12-15 11:11:25 UTC
rarity
common
prev
next